Hacienda style kitchen has a unique charm that blends rustic warmth with a dash of elegance. Originating from old Spanish colonial architecture, this style is characterized by large spaces, vibrant colors, natural materials, and a homely feel.

Embrace Natural Materials

Natural materials are a cornerstone of hacienda design. Think about incorporating elements like stone, wood, and clay into your kitchen.

Wooden Beams

Exposed wooden beams can add warmth and a touch of grandeur. You can choose from a variety of woods, like oak or pine. Even reclaimed wood gives a rustic yet refined look.

Stone Countertops

Opting for granite or soapstone can elevate your kitchen. These materials not only look great but they’re also durable. You’ll appreciate the unique patterns that each stone holds.

Handcrafted Tiles

Mexican-inspired handcrafted tiles can serve as a stunning backsplash. These tiles often feature intricate designs and vibrant colors. You can mix and match them for a playful effect.

Color Palette

A key element of hacienda-style kitchens is the color palette. Bright colors and earthy tones should dominate your space.

Warm Earthy Tones

Think terracotta, warm browns, and muted greens. These tones create a cozy atmosphere that makes everyone feel at home.

Bold Accents

Don’t shy away from using bold colors as accents. Red, turquoise, or saffron can add a beautiful contrast. You could use these colors in wall art, decorative items, or even in your dishware.

Calming Whites

White-painted cabinets or walls can help balance the vibrant colors. This can make your kitchen feel spacious and airy, while still maintaining the hacienda vibe.

Rustic Furniture

Furniture choice is crucial in setting the ambiance. Rustic, weathered furniture can add character to your kitchen.

Wooden Dining Tables

A large, sturdy wooden dining table serves as both a functional and aesthetic centerpiece. Consider a farmhouse style or a long table for gatherings.

Wrought Iron Chairs

Pair your table with wrought iron chairs or benches. These lend an industrial touch while still being consistent with the hacienda style.

Open Shelving

Open shelving made from reclaimed wood can display your beautiful dishware. It not only adds storage but also offers a rustic appeal.

Lighting In Hacienda style kitchen

Good lighting is essential in any kitchen. Consider both natural and artificial light sources.

Large Windows

Maximize natural light with big windows. They can be framed with wooden accents for a cohesive look. This also brings the outdoors in, which aligns perfectly with the hacienda ethos.

Pendant Lights

Hanging pendant lights made of wrought iron or glass can serve as gorgeous focal points. Opt for intricate designs that reflect your overall kitchen theme.

Lanterns

Using lanterns whether overhead or on the countertops can provide a rustic feel. They add a romantic touch and can be filled with candles for a cozy glow.
